This is a list of mobile suits from the Japanese novel series Mobile Suit Gundam Unicorn by Harutoshi Fukui and set during the Universal Century timeline.

The series' titular mobile suit, the Unicorn is a product of the "UC Project," part of the Earth Federation Space Force's reorganization plan. Painted fully in white, the RX-0 is designed as a new mobile suit developed by the Vist Foundation. The experimental machine contains a psycoframe, a special "Laplace Program" OS that turns the enemy's psycommu weapons against them and the so-called NT-D system which triggers the Unicorn's Destroy Mode. In Destroy Mode, the Unicorn's armor plates slide out at several locations, revealing a glowing red inner frame while the head transforms into the familiar Gundam head. The machine's performance in Destroy Mode is improved, but can only last for five minutes, after which it reverts to Unicorn Mode and is drifting in space. The RX-0 is equipped with a new beam magnum gun, a hyper bazooka, a shield with an I-field barrier, two beam sabers, two beam tonfas, and a beam gatling gun. Later in the series, the RX-0 appears in a Full-Armor version, featuring multiple bazookas, gatling guns, and missile pods. The red psycoframe turns into green when the Banshee is close by.
Appearing in the novel's eighth volume, "Black Unicorn" and in the ending of the OVA episode "In the Depths of the Gravity Well," the Banshee is a more powerful version of the Unicorn. The most visible difference between the two is that the Banshee sports a black color scheme, a gold inner lining when in Destroy Mode, and a different head crest. Where the gold only covers the head crest in Unicorn mode, the OVA version in particular has a gold color on the faceplate and part of the chest area. The OVA Banshee also sports a beam cannon in the right forearm and a massive heat claw on the left forearm. The Sleeves steal the Banshee, but the Nahel Argama crew eventually recover it and assign Riddhe Marcenas as the pilot.
Dubbed the "Refined Zeta Escort Leader," the ReZEL was another attempt to mass-produce the MSZ-006 Zeta Gundam, after the failure of the RGZ-91 ReGZ. It uses the basic frame of the RGM-89 Jegan, and has a transformation system similar to the MSA-005 Methuss. It is armed with a beam rifle, a beam cannon housed inside the shield, and a pair of head vulcans. The Londo Bell taskforce aboard the Nahel Argama has at least three ReZELs, one of which is a special commander's unit piloted by Norm Basilicock.
A transformable tank, the Loto appears in the series as a ground assault mobile suit deployed with the ECOAS anti-insurgency unit. It possesses optical camouflage and can carry two infantry squads. It is equipped with a beam burner, machine gun, and a choice of two 120mm cannons or a Gatling gun. The Loto is the predecessor of the RXR-44 Guntank that appeared in Gundam F91 and is also the smallest mobile suit in the series, at 12 meters.
The Delta Plus is a variable mobile suit developed by Anaheim Electronics and supplied to the Nahel Argama after most of its MS complement is lost in combat against the Kshatriya in the first episode of the OVA series. An offshoot of an Anaheim Electronics project that resulted in the MSN-00100 Hyaku Shiki from Z Gundam, it is designed for trans-atmospheric flight. It is equipped with a beam rifle, a beam saber, Vulcan gun and a shield. Earth Federation Space Force officer Riddhe Marcenas is the pilot of one Delta Plus assigned to the Nahel Argama.
First appearing in Char's Counterattack, the Jegan is the Earth Federation Space Force's most common mobile suit in service at the start of Gundam Unicorn. The D model is an upgrade of the original Jegan.
First appearing in the Mobile Suit Variations model series and as an SD model kit, the Stark Jegan is depicted in Gundam Unicorn as a fire-support version of the Jegan. It is equipped with shoulder missile launchers, more armor plates, and a bazooka, in addition to the Jegan's standard weapons. One such copy is in service with the Londo Bell at the start of the series, but is destroyed in combat against Kshatriya in the first episode.
Anaheim Electronics' proposed successor to the Jegan, the Jesta has a dark blue color scheme reminiscent of the RGM-79Q GM Quell. Aside from standard mobile suit weapons, the Jesta is also armed with a new beam carbine rifle. The Earth Federation assigns 12 Jestas to the Nahel Argama to provide support for the Unicorn Gundam when it is finished with its Destroy Mode. It first appears in the novel "In the Depths of a Gravity Well" as the Federation mobilizes ground units to defend Dakar against the attack of the Neo-Zeon's Shamblo mobile armor.

The Neo Zeon rebel group dubbed "The Sleeves" are called as such because their mobile suits have special arm cuffs and chest plates that denote rank depending on the intricacy of their designs. This applies to all Zeon mobile suits left over from previous wars that The Sleeves somehow acquire.
The biggest Neo-Zeon mobile suit at the start of the series (at 22.6 meters), the Kshatriya resembles the NZ-000 Quin Mantha from Gundam ZZ. It is armed with 12 mega-particle cannons, two beam sabers, and 24 funnels spread out across four binders. The Kshatriya is piloted by Marida Cruz, who is captured along with the unit after it is heavily damaged in the episode "Ghost of Laplace."
Full Frontal's personal machine, the Sinanju was originally an Anaheim Electronics testbed for the Unicorn Gundam's NT-D System and psycoframe. Like its predecessor, the MSN-04 Sazabi, the Sinanju is painted in red. The Neo Zeon stole the Sinanju two years before the events of the series.
A Neo Zeon mass-production mobile suit, the Geara Zulu is the successor to the AMS-119 Geara Doga that was introduced in Char's Counterattack. The line versions of the Geara Zulu, which are usually painted in green, are equipped with a beam machine gun (resembling the StG 44) and its grenade launcher attachment, hand grenades, rocket launcher, beam axe, and shield. Members of the Sleeves' Elite Guard pilot green Geara Zulus that are more bulkier and identifiable by their spiked shoulder plates and white trim lines. A unit assigned to Guard commander Angelo Sauper is equipped with a shield and a Langebruno cannon. The Guards' Geara Zulus are also modified for higher power output to help them keep up with the Sinanju.
First appearing in Char's Counterattack, the Geara Doga is the predecessor of the Geara Zulu. A heavy-weapons version that was originally part of Char's Counterattack's Mobile Suit Variations series appears in Unicorn as well.
First appearing in Stardust Memory as an improvised unit, the Dra-C is a space-only mobile suit. The version appearing in Gundam Unicorn has been upgraded with a gatling gun and is painted in pink and violet.
The faction is a group of Zeon forces left behind on Earth after the One-Year War and link up with the Sleeves. Their mobile suits are reconditioned machines.
A successor to the Brawbro from the original series, the Shamblo is a massive underwater mobile armor designed for heavy assault and breakthrough strikes. It is powered by a Minovsky drive, a caterpillar and a nuclear-hover system, plus being equipped with a mega-particle cannon, reflective bits, a missile launcher, and claws that have anti-beam coating. It makes its only appearance in the novel "In the Depths of a Gravity Well" as the Neo-Zeon attack Dakar and kill as many Federation forces as they can. In the novels, a four-man crew is required because of its massive size - which in this case, is Neo-Zeon supporter Mahadi Garvey and his three children - Lonnie, Walid, and Abbas - at different stations. Lonnie Garvey is the Shamblo's only pilot in the OVA series.
First developed during the events of Gundam ZZ, the Gallus-K is a derivative of the Neo-Zeon's original Gallus-J. Remnant forces modified their Gallus-Ks by replacing the mobile suit's missile systems with beam cannons.
A left-over design from the First Gryps War depicted in Z Gundam, the Marasai's Zeonic appearance endears itself to the Remnant, who acquire several units by the time of the events of Gundam Unicorn. Unlike the Marasais used by the Titans, the Remnant Marasais are painted in the same standard two-tone green color scheme as Zakus.
One of the Principality of Zeon's first mobile suits designed for underwater operations, the Z'Gok boasts of sufficient firepower and agility on land and sea.
